What is Château d'Esclans known for?

It's the Provence estate behind Whispering Angel — the wine that, more than any other, turned premium pale rosé into a global phenomenon. Bought by Sacha Lichine in 2005/06, d'Esclans set out to make the world's finest rosés and is widely credited with igniting the rosé renaissance.

What's the difference between the d'Esclans rosés?

They're a tiered range, all dry Provence rosé but rising in richness and complexity: Whispering Angel is the famous, approachable entry; Rock Angel a step up; Les Clans more serious still; and Garrus, from old vines, the flagship. The estate is now owned by luxury group LVMH.
